Each time I do a complete new re-install of my FS 2002, with everything set to my best settings, (generally Max), my ATC traffic set to 100%, or whatever, the ground and skies are full of AI aircraft, and ATC are full of annoying chatter...as they do...!

Now...

After I have installed my various add-ons to FS 2002, all my AI traffic is competely non-existant, both in the air and on the ground!

My various add-ons:

FS Navigator.
Lago Flight Sim Scenery Enhancer, (FSSE), populating my airfields.
FSUIPC.
Gerrish Greys Trees.
New road textures.
California accurate DEM meshes.
Santa Rosa to San Diego area, (California Pacific Coast), scenery meshes.
Los Angeles Airport,(KLAX), add-on scenery.
Weather Maker.
Runway Maker.
FSSC created extra NDB add-ons.
Water effects. (Flight Water Pro).
Various 3rd. party aircraft, ships, vehicles, etc.
Plus a few little odds and sods to enhance California and the surrounding area...(Sun, sand, beach babes, etc...)...LOL...!

All the default aircraft, Boeings, etc, are in my hangar, as they should be, but now they do not appear as AI traffic anymore, in the air, on the ground or as ATC reports in the skies...!!
Setting ATC to 100% makes no effect. (100% also appears in the FS 2002.cfg file).
All the boxes, etc are ticked in Options > Settings > ATC, and the slider set to 100% traffic.

Note: I have tried going to other airports to look for AI traffic....nuffin'....!

Any idea what could have altered in the program to exclude all AI traffic after including my add-ons...?

Going back to your original post.  Did you mean that all default aircraft are in your Aircraft folder, but all have been overwritten with new textures and the aircraft.cfg files were revised accordingly?

When I changed all the default textures about two years ago, I seem to remember that the AI went away unless the new textures were named texture, texture.1 and texture.2.

Also, the titles may have to read Paint 1 or Paint 2, etc.  Look at the original aircraft.cfg and follow that format. 

That seemed to work for me.  Hope this helps.

Whenever I have a problem with missing AI traffic, the first thing I always do is check the fs2002/Aircraft folder to make sure the file "default.dp" is still there.  If it isn't, then it can be extracted from the .CAB file on fs2002 Disk 1.

However, if you believe the that one of your scenery add-ons is causing the problem, with fs2002 open go into Settings and then Scenery Library and try disabling each of your add-ons to see if the traffic re-appears.

Finally found the problem after de-selecting some of my add-on scenery stage by stage.... Shocked...!
The problem finally came down to my LAGO FSSE add-on objects for all my airfields...!!
I had a choice, either display my add-on scenery and loose my AI aircraft and ATC, or display my AI aircraft and ATC and loose my add-on scenery....
BUGGAR... Angry...!
At the moment, after all the years I have been populating my airfields with LAGO's objects, (you will have noticed in my screen shots), I am having to loose them all just to get AI working properly...!
BUGGAR, BUGGAR...!
Quite why scenery objects should interfere with AI and ATC, I don't know....must have a word with the lads on the LAGO Forum... Roll Eyes...!

Before I un-install my Flight Sims, I first save all my add-ons: Aircraft, gauges, effects, scenery, etc.... Smiley....!
Then, when I have re-installed the flight sim I move all my add-on bits and pieces back into their correct folders...!
BUT....!
In the case of LAGO's Flight Sim Scenery Enhancer, (FSSE), the program HAD to be downloaded, (all 29 Mb!), and re-installed again, otherwise it conflicted with the default ATC and default AI aircraft.... Cry....!
....don't ask me why... Roll Eyes...!

Anyway, all is a bed bed of roses now..... Grin...!
All my FSSE generated airfields, and my ATC, and my AI aircraft are all present and correct again....SIR.... 8)...!
